Introduction
Toys are more than just objects of fun—they are powerful tools that help shape a child’s development. From cognitive growth to social skills, the right toys can make a significant difference in how children learn and interact with the world around them. In this article, we’ll explore why playtime with toys is essential for your child’s overall growth.
1. Boosts Cognitive Skills
Playtime encourages problem-solving, creativity, and critical thinking. For example:
-
Building Blocks help children understand balance, shapes, and spatial awareness.
-
Puzzle Games improve memory and concentration.
Through hands-on play, children learn to experiment, explore, and make decisions—skills that will benefit them for life.
2. Develops Fine and Gross Motor Skills
Whether it’s stacking blocks or riding a toy car, toys help strengthen both fine and gross motor skills:
-
Fine Motor Skills: Activities like coloring, Lego building, or playing with clay improve hand-eye coordination.
-
Gross Motor Skills: Ride-on cars, balls, and outdoor toys promote body coordination and strength.
3. Enhances Social and Emotional Growth
Toys often serve as a bridge for social interaction. Role-play sets like kitchen toys or doctor kits allow children to:
-
Practice empathy
-
Develop communication skills
-
Learn teamwork
Sharing toys and playing in groups also helps kids understand the concept of cooperation and patience.
4. Sparks Creativity and Imagination
Pretend play is one of the most powerful ways to nurture creativity. Dolls, action figures, and building kits inspire kids to create their own stories and scenarios—boosting imaginative thinking and problem-solving skills.
5. Encourages Emotional Expression
Play can help children express their feelings in a safe and healthy way. Toys act as an outlet for emotions, helping kids manage stress and develop resilience.
